I wanted to let you all know about some exciting new selection we just launched supported by a new technology.

As of today, Amazon.com will be offering Free to Play and MMO games that you can purchase virtual goods, currencies, and subscriptions for on Amazon.com. These purchases will be delivered directly into your game account. We're calling this new service Game Connect.

Amazon has teamed up with our launch partners to bring Amazon customers exclusive content and bonus offers for the opening of the Free to Play store. Here is some of the cool stuff you'll get just for linking your Amazon account with a game account:

[quote name='houdinilogic']has anyone picked up the dragon age bundle? i'm wondering if it comes with individual keys for the two games (and in particular, if gifting DA:O is possible as i already have a copy).[/QUOTE]

You'll get three keys, one for the Dragon Age Ultimate (the base game and expansion), one for the DLC for DAO, and one for DA2. You're free to give anyone you want the keys you don't need, when I bought it I had Origins and Awakening but was missing most of the other DLC, so I gave that key away and activated the DLC for myself. BTW, if you have purchased any DLC and do that (I already had Warden's Keep), you won't be able to gift your "extra" copy of the dlc.
